As Louise came back home from a day out with friends, she noticed a note pinned to their door, reading ‘meet me down the back’. As she walked around the corner to the backyard she was met by Andrew, bent on one knee. Having spent the afternoon setting up fairy lights with the help of his buddies, Andrew had also organised for a private chef to cook the couple dinner-post proposal (she said yes of course!)

Keeping in theme with the beautiful sandstone of The Cell Block Theatre, they kept the tone of the wedding simple and romantic, with food by Gallivant Events and a whole lot of greenery from She Designs to complement the venue. In the lead up to their day, Louise purchased over 100 tiny succulents, which she re-planted at her mother’s house. “She watered and nurtured them as if they were her children, closely monitoring them for any signs they were dying.” A week before her wedding, Louise replanted the little guys into tiny pots, hand painted with a thank you note to each of their guests.

Four weeks out from their wedding Louise had a change of heart with her dress, adding, “style is huge to me and I just knew that I needed to feel like me on the day. I then went on a mad search to find it.” She discovered the wonderful work of the Karen Willis Holmes girls, who miraculously managed to create a gown for her in the short time span. “From their staff in the store to Sue the lovely seamstress, they were all lovely and helped in any way they could.”

Enlisting the work of photographer Alex Marks, the couple were blown away with his professionalism and ease, adding he was fun to work with and made everyone feel comfortable.
